At least 90% of the best songs are under three minutes long. They just are; it’s a music fact.
Zac Farro’s ‘Telephone’ is a great example: clocking in at a little over a minute, it’s a breezy, summery number that soon has you wanting to hit repeat; and could easily end up soundtracking your entire afternoon.
The accompanying video – premiering today via Dork, no less – is similarly relaxed, with Zac chilling out with dreamy visuals courtesy of multimedia artist Mike Kludge.
“Making the ‘Telephone’ video was a rad experience,” says Zac. “The director Mike Kludge has so much vintage video gear that it doesn’t require much of a performance from the artist to make it look exciting. Being that the song is only a little over a minute long and the lyrics are very straight forward, it felt right for this video for me to stay stationary and just let Mike do his thing.”
‘Telephone’ is taken from Zac’s new Halfnoise album, ‘Sudden Feeling’ out 9th September via Congrats! Records. Watch the video below.
